Sooner or later most guitar students like to have a dabble at playing the blues and therefore books such as «Petits Blues« are to be welcomed, aimed as it is towards the grade 3-4+ player.
The first two compositions, Missouri Blues and Louisiana Blues are very weIl written and entertaining pieces for the lower intermediate student (...and) the other four pieces (...) all call for a higher technical standard. However these other four are delightful to play and are sure to be winners with the student wishing to explore the fingerboard a little more using this style of music.
